Volume Accumulation : The first part of the script checks for a new 5-minute interval and accumulates the volume of the current interval. It separates the volume into buying volume and selling volume based on whether the closing price is closer to the high or low of the bar.
Volume Normalization and Pressure Calculation : The script then normalizes the volume with a 20-period EMA, and calculates buying pressure, selling pressure, and total pressure. These calculations provide insight into the underlying demand (buying pressure) and supply (selling pressure) conditions in the market.
RSI Calculation and Overbought/Oversold Conditions : The script calculates the RSI (Relative Strength Index) and checks whether it is in an overbought (RSI > 70) or oversold (RSI < 30) state. The RSI is a momentum indicator, providing insights into the speed and change of price movements.
Volume Condition Check and Wondertrend Indicator : The script checks if the volume is high for the past five bars. If it is, it applies the Wondertrend Indicator, which uses a combination of the Parabolic SAR (Stop and Reverse) and Keltner Channel to identify potential trends in the market.
Swing High/Low and Fibonacci Retracement : The script identifies swing high and swing low points using a specified pivot length. Then, it draws Fibonacci retracement levels between these swing high and swing low points.

TRAPPER TRENDLINES — RSIBuilds dynamic RSI trendlines by connecting the two most recent confirmed RSI swing points (highs→highs for resistance, lows→lows for support). Includes optional channel shading for the 30–70 zone, an RSI moving average, clean break alerts, and simple bullish/bearish divergence alerts versus price.
How it works
RSI pivots: A point on RSI is a swing high/low only if it is the most extreme value compared with a set number of bars on the left and the right (the Pivot Lookback).
RSI trendlines:
Resistance connects the last two confirmed RSI swing highs.
Support connects the last two confirmed RSI swing lows.
Lines can be Full Extend (update into the future) or Pivot Only.
Channel block: Optional fill of the 30–70 range for fast visual context.
Alerts:
Breaks of RSI support/resistance trendlines.
Basic bullish/bearish RSI divergences versus price pivots.

Trendline Breakout Navigator [LuxAlgo]The Trendline Breakout Navigator indicator shows three trendlines, representing trends of different significance between Swing Points.
Dots highlight a Higher Low (HL) or Lower High (LH) that pierces through the Trendline without the closing price breaking the Trendline.
A bar color and background color option is included, which offers insights into the price against the trendlines.
🔶 USAGE
Trendlines (TL) are drawn, starting as a horizontal line from a Swing Point.
When an HL (in the case of a bullish TL) or an LH (bearish TL) is found, this Swing Point is connected to the first Swing Point. In both cases, the TL can be optimized when one or more historical close prices breach the TL (see DETAILS).
A solid-styled long-term trendline represents the overall market direction, while a dashed-styled medium-term trendline captures medium-term movements within the long-term trend. Finally, a dotted-styled short-term trendline tracks short-term fluctuations.
🔹 Swing Points vs. Trend
A "Higher High" (HH) or "Lower Low" (LL) will initialize a new trendline, respectively, starting from the previous "Swing Low" or Swing High".
To spot the trend shift, "HH/LL" labels and an optional background color are included. They can be enabled/disabled or set at "Long, Medium, or Short" term TL (Settings—"MS", "HH/LL" and "Background Color").
These features are linked to one Trendline of choice only.
Where the "HH/LL" labels can show a potential trend shift, the background color is:
Green from the moment the close price breaks above a bearish trendline or when an HH occurs
Red from the moment the close price breaks below a bullish trendline or when an LL occurs
🔹 Bar Color
The bar color will depend on the location of the closing price against the three trendlines. When a trendline is unavailable (for example, if the close price breaks the TL and there is no HH/LL), the last known trendline value will be considered.
All three trendlines influence the bar color.
If the close price is above the "Long Term" TL, the bar color will show a gradient of green, darker when the close price is below the "Medium Term" and/or "Short Term" TLs.
On the other hand, when the close price is below the "Long Term" TL, the bar color will show a gradient of red, which becomes darker when the close price is above the "Medium Term" and/or "Short Term" TLs.
To keep the above example simple, only the "Long Term" TL is considered. The white line (not included in the script) resembles the actual value of the TL at each bar, where you can see the effect on the bar color.
Combined with the trendlines and dots, the bar color can provide extra depth and insights into the underlying trends.
🔹 Tested Trendlines
If a new HL/LH pierces the Trendline without the close price breaking the Trendline, the Trendline will be updated.
The exact location where the price exceeded the Trendline is visualized by a dot, colored blue on a bullish trendline and orange when bearish.
These dots can be indicative of a potential trend continuation or reversal.
🔹 Higher TimeFrame Option
The "Period" setting enables users to visualize higher-timeframe trendlines as long as the line length doesn't exceed 5000 bars.
🔶 DETAILS
When a new trendline is drawn, the script first draws a preliminary line and then checks whether a historical close price exceeded this line above (in the case of a bearish TL) or below (in a bullish case).
Subsequently, the most valid point in between is chosen as the starting point of the Trendline.

Smart Impulse Exhaustion Finder (ATR + ADX Filter)📌 Purpose
This indicator detects potential exhaustion of strong bullish or bearish impulses at fresh swing highs/lows by combining multiple price action and volatility-based filters.
🧠 How It Works
A signal is triggered only when all core conditions are satisfied:
1. Swing High/Low Detection
Current high (or low) must be the highest (or lowest) over the last Extremum Lookback bars (default: 50).
This ensures the move is significant relative to recent price action.
2. Impulse Confirmation
Price must extend by at least 1 × ATR from the previous swing point.
This filters out minor fluctuations.
3. Exhaustion Conditions (at least 2 out of 3 must be met)
RSI Extreme: RSI > Overbought Level (default: 80) for bearish signals, RSI < Oversold Level (default: 20) for bullish signals.
Volume Spike: Volume > SMA(Volume, Volume SMA Length) × Volume Spike Multiplier.
Candle Wick Rejection: Upper wick ≥ Wick Threshold % for bearish setups, Lower wick ≥ Wick Threshold % for bullish setups.
4. Trend Filter
ADX > ADX Threshold ensures the market is trending and filters out sideways conditions.
5. Candle Body Filter
Candle body must be ≥ Body Size ATR Factor × ATR.
This avoids weak signals from small candles or doji formations.

2. Core Concepts
At its heart, the Squeeze Pro builds an in-chart visualization of the TTM Squeeze, a strategy that identifies when price volatility compresses inside a Bollinger Band that is narrower than a Keltner Channel. These moments often precede explosive breakouts. This version categorizes squeezes into three levels of compression:
• Blue Dot – Low Compression
• Orange Dot – Medium Compression
• Red Dot – High Compression
When the squeeze “fires” (i.e., the Bollinger Bands expand beyond all Keltner thresholds), the indicator flips to a Green Dot, signaling potential entry if confirmed by trend direction.
The indicator also includes a momentum model using linear regression on smoothed price deviation to determine directional bias. Momentum is further reinforced by a customizable trend engine, allowing you to switch between EMA-21 or HMA 34/144 logic.
An ALMA ribbon is plotted across the chart to represent smoothed trend strength with minimal lag, and a scroll-aware VWAP (Volume-Weighted Average Price) line, optionally with ±σ bands, helps confirm mean-reversion or momentum continuation setups.

Pure Price Action Order & Breaker Blocks [LuxAlgo]The Pure Price Action Order & Breaker Blocks indicator is a pure price action adaptation of our previously published and highly popular Order-Blocks-Breaker-Blocks script.
Similar to its earlier version, this indicator detects order blocks that can automatically turn into breaker blocks on the chart once mitigated. However, the key difference/uniqueness is that the pure price action version relies solely on price patterns, eliminating the need for length definitions. In other words, it removes the limitation of user-defined inputs, ensuring a robust and objective analysis of market dynamics.
🔶 USAGE
An order block is a significant area on a price chart where there was a notable accumulation or distribution of orders, often identified by a strong price move followed by consolidation. Traders use order blocks to identify potential support or resistance levels.
A mitigated order block refers to an order block that has been invalidated due to subsequent market movements. It may no longer hold the same significance in the current market context. However, when the price mitigates an order block, a breaker block is confirmed. It is possible that the price might trade back to this breaker block, potentially offering a new trading opportunity.
Users can optionally enable the "Historical Polarity Changes" labels within the settings menu to see where breaker blocks might have previously provided effective trade setups.
This feature is most effective when using replay mode. Please note that these labels are subject to backpainting.
🔶 DETAILS
The swing points detection feature relies exclusively on price action, eliminating the need for numerical user-defined settings.
The first step involves detecting short-term swing points, where a short-term swing high (STH) is identified as a price peak surrounded by lower highs on both sides. Similarly, a short-term swing low is recognized as a price trough surrounded by higher lows on both sides.
Intermediate-term swing and long-term swing points are detected using the same approach but with a slight modification. Instead of directly analyzing price candles, we now utilize the previously detected short-term swing points. For intermediate-term swing points, we rely on short-term swing points, while for long-term swing points, we use the intermediate-term ones.

Internal Pivot Pattern [LuxAlgo]The Internal Pivot Pattern indicator is a novel method allowing traders to detect pivots without excessive delay on the chart timeframe, by using the lower timeframe data from a candle.
It features custom colors for candles and zigzag lines to help identify trends. A dashboard showing the accuracy of the pattern is also included.
🔶 USAGE
We define a pivot as the occurrence where the middle candle over a specific interval (for example, the most recent 21 bars) is the highest (pivot high) or the lowest (pivot low). This method commonly allows for identifying swing highs/lows on a trader's chart; however, this pattern can only be identified after a specific number of bars has been formed, rendering this pattern useless for real-time detection of swing highs/lows.
This indicator uses a different approach, removing the need to wait for candles to form on the user chart; instead, we check the lower timeframe data of the current candle and evaluate for the presence of a pivot given the internal data, effectively providing pivot confirmation at the candle close.
An internal pivot low pattern is indicative of a potential uptrend, while an internal pivot high is indicative of a potential downtrend.
Candles are colored based on the last internal pivot detected, with blue candle colors indicating that the most recent internal pivot is a pivot low, indicating an uptrend, while an orange candle color indicates that the most recent internal pivot is a pivot high, indicating a downtrend.
🔹 Timeframes
The timeframe setting allows controlling the amount of lower timeframe data to consider for the internal pivot detection. This setting must be lower than the user's chart timeframe.
Using a timeframe significantly lower than the user chart timeframe will evaluate a larger amount of data for the pivot detection, making it less frequent, while using a timeframe closer to the chart timeframe can make the internal pivot detection more frequent, and more prone to false positives.
🔹 Accuracy Dashboard
The Accuracy Dashboard allows evaluating how accurate the detected patterns are as a percentage, with a pattern being judged accurate if subsequent patterns are detected higher or lower than a previous one.
For example, an internal pivot low is judged accurate if the following internal pivot is higher than it, indicating that higher highs have been made.
This dashboard can be useful to determine the timeframe setting to maximize the respective internal pivot accuracy.

Dynamic Liquidity Depth [BigBeluga]
Dynamic Liquidity Depth
A liquidity mapping engine that reveals hidden zones of market vulnerability. This tool simulates where potential large concentrations of stop-losses may exist — above recent highs (sell-side) and below recent lows (buy-side) — by analyzing real price behavior and directional volume. The result is a dynamic two-sided volume profile that highlights where price is most likely to gravitate during liquidation events, reversals, or engineered stop hunts.
🔵 KEY FEATURES
Two-Sided Liquidity Profiles:
Plots two separate profiles on the chart — one above price for potential sell-side liquidity , and one below price for potential buy-side liquidity . Each profile reflects the volume distribution across binned zones derived from historical highs and lows.
Real Stop Zone Simulation:
Each profile is offset from the current high or low using an ATR-based buffer. This simulates where traders might cluster their stop-losses above swing highs (short stops) or below swing lows (long stops).
Directional Volume Analysis:
Buy-side volume is accumulated only from bullish candles (close > open), while sell-side volume is accumulated only from bearish candles (close < open). This directional filtering enhances accuracy by capturing genuine pressure zones.
Dynamic Volume Heatmap:
Each liquidity bin is rendered as a horizontal box with a color gradient based on volume intensity:
- Low activity bins are shaded lightly.
- High-volume zones appear more vividly in red (sell) or lime (buy).
- The maximum volume bin in each profile is emphasized with a brighter fill and a volume label.
Extended POC Zones:
The Point of Control (PoC) — the bin with the most volume — is extended backwards across the entire lookback period to mark critical resistance (sell-side) or support (buy-side) levels.
Total Volume Summary Labels:
At the center of each profile, a summary label displays Total Buy Liquidity and Total Sell Liquidity volume.
This metric helps assess directional imbalance — when buy liquidity is dominant, the market may favor upward continuation, and vice versa.
Customizable Profile Granularity:
You can fine-tune both Resolution (Bins) and Offset Distance to adjust how far profiles are displaced from price and how many levels are calculated within the ATR range.
🔵 HOW IT WORKS
The indicator calculates an ATR-based buffer above highs and below lows to define the top and bottom of the liquidity zones.
Using a user-defined lookback period, it scans historical candles and divides the buffered zones into bins.
Each bin checks if bullish (or bearish) candles pass through it based on price wicks and body.
Volume from valid candles is summed into the corresponding bin.
When volume exists in a bin, a horizontal box is drawn with a width scaled by relative volume strength.
The bin with the highest volume is highlighted and optionally extended backward as a zone of importance.
Total buy/sell liquidity is displayed with a summary label at the side of the profile.
